Principle Based Play – The Key to Freedom is a Beautiful Framework with Elaine Vassie

This principle-based play session is designed for rugby coaches seeking to explore and understand more on the value of principle driven frameworks against more traditional game models or systems. Participants will explore the foundations of a principle-based model, and how this can be translated to shared mental models, whilst allowing for individual expression, and accelerated on field decision making. Through interactive activities, demonstrations, and collaborative discussions, coaches will learn how to create a learning environment that encourages players to think critically, adapt to situations confidently and make effective decisions on the field.

Game Planning with SWOT Analysis: Uncovering Insights for Winning Strategies in Rugby with Gordon Hanlon

This dynamic course is designed for rugby professionals who seek to enhance their strategic thinking and decision-making abilities through SWOT (Strengths, Weaknesses, Opportunities, and Threats) analysis. Participants will learn the methodology of conducting a comprehensive SWOT analysis specific to rugby contexts, evaluating internal factors such as team composition, coaching staff, facilities, and financial resources, as well as external factors like market competition, player recruitment, and technological advancements. By exploring real-world case studies and engaging in interactive discussions, attendees will gain practical insights into how SWOT analysis can inform critical strategic decisions, improve performance, and optimize the overall direction of their rugby initiatives. The course empowers participants to become astute strategists who can leverage the power of SWOT analysis for sustainable success in the ever-evolving rugby landscape.

The Art of Scrummaging: Developing Stronger, Safer, and More Dominant Rugby Packs with Mary Swanstrom

This comprehensive course is designed to equip rugby players and coaches with the knowledge and skills to excel in scrummaging and dominate the set piece battles. Participants will explore the technical aspects of scrum engagement, body positioning, binding, and driving techniques. Through practical demonstrations, specialized drills, and analysis, attendees will develop a deep understanding of scrum dynamics and the intricacies of effective scrummaging. Coaches will gain insights into coaching methodologies, effective communication with players, and strategies for optimizing scrum performance. By the end of the course, participants will be equipped with new tools to execute powerful and cohesive scrums, providing their teams with a competitive edge on the field.

Building a Dynamic Lineout: Tactics, Variations, and Execution for Success with Gordon Hanlon

This specialized course is designed for rugby players and coaches seeking to elevate their lineout skills and tactical understanding. Participants will dive deep into the nuances of lineout play, exploring advanced techniques such as specialized lifts, deceptive movements, effective communication, and innovative lineout strategies. Through a combination of theoretical instruction, practical exercises, and game analysis, attendees will develop a tactical edge in the lineout, enhancing their ability to win possession, disrupt opponent’s throws, and execute intelligent set piece plays. Coaches will gain insights into designing tailored lineout strategies, analyzing opponent’s lineout patterns, and developing cohesive lineout units. By the end of the course, participants will possess the expertise to excel in lineouts, contribute to team success, and become strategic tacticians in the game of rugby.
